New Delhi: State-run Rural Electrification Corp (REC) said it has raised $400 million through a dollar bond issue.

The issue concluded in London on Monday. The bond is priced at 115 basis points over three years US Treasury and is for refinancing the existing external commercial borrowings, first of its kind by any Indian PSU, an official statement said.

This is the second international bond transaction by REC this year. The company had raised green bonds of $450 million in July this year.
